I had the honor and privilege of attending the North American debut of the Jeff Koons BMW M3 GT2 Art Car at Art Basel in Miami this week, and figured if there's any place on Bimmerpost that will appreciate these photos, it's M3Post!

For those not familiar, BMW has a 38 year tradition of taking race cars and having a famous artist paint them. The first one was the Andy Warhol M1 (also on display in Miami right now - hoping to go see it today!). This M3 GT2, which raced in 24 Hours of LeMans in 2010, is the 17th and currently last BMW Art Car.

The setup for the BMW M3 GT2 event at Art Basel, Miami was nothing short of spectacular. Hats off to the BMW marketing team for their hard work putting this together.



Several speakers, including who I believe is the head of BMW NA and Jeff Koons himself, the artist who painted the car, spoke at the event prior to the unveiling. Jeff Koons described the inspiration for the art, which is meant to look like it's warping off of the car, and how the final result is actually Plan B because Plan A was going to add too much weight to this race car.
